self-advocates formed hundreds of groups around the United States and the world. Many of those groups are called People First, but have many other names. [6] In 1990, Self Advocates Becoming Empowered (SABE), the first American national self-advocacy organization was created by self-advocates, including Roland Johnson. [7]

At 3 months, children employ different cries for different needs. At 6 months they can recognize and imitate the basic sounds of spoken language. In the first 3 years, children need to be exposed to communication with others in order to pick up language. "Normal" language development is measured by the rate of vocabulary acquisition. [21]
